you could also try segedins truck & auto (they're near the airport(auckland)) www.segedins.co.nz I got a
timing belt & water pump (may as well do them both while you're at it)
for $112 inc gst. the part numbers are TB145YU22 (belt) and WPMZ-35A
(pump) if you want to check the price on the website. best to confirm
the numbers with them before you buy...
